Privacy/Confidentiality
No users at PICS will have any expectation of privacy/confidentiality in the content of electronic communications or other computer files sent and received on the school computer systems or stored in his/her directory. The Systems Administrator may at any time review the subject, content, and appropriateness of electronic communications or computer files.
Disclaimer of Liability
PICS’ computer system is connected to the internet and while PICS does its best to filter, block and supervise objectionable content and sites it is possible that users may be exposed to unwanted material. It is impossible for any network system to block all objectionable content, and PICS is not responsible for any information found or displayed on the internet. PICS is not responsible for ensuring the accuracy or usability of any information found on the internet.
PICS cannot guarantee 100% system availability. In the event of an outage, students are still responsible for completing assignments using computers either at home, or at a location where computers can be utilized such as a public library.
PICS is not responsible for any lost student data, and students must ensure that files are backed up on personal memory keys.
Termination of Access
PICS may at any time suspend the rights and responsibilities of any user upon violation of the General and/or acceptable usage policies. Termination or suspension of access may at the discretion of administration last up to the remainder of the school year. While access is revoked, users are responsible for completing assignments or work on time using systems either at home, or at a local library.
